    New Wave is my favorite local Comic Book Shop. Jason and co. are the nicest people, and are happy…read moreto welcome anyone, whether it's their first time or they come in every week. This isn't a snoody insider shop, where an angry neckbeard will laugh at you for not knowing your Image from your Darkhorse. These folks are happy to help anybody with their first venture into comics, or will kindly leave the veterans to browse. They will set up a pull-list for you, if you want to keep up to date on the latest issues, which is even easier and more convenient to do from home if you use Facebook or Instagram. Just follow their posts and comment on their new release postings to pre-order anything in advance. And my favorite Sunday activity is following their weekly "Claims," where they feature new-to-the-store key issues and bundles at great deals. It's also a great spot for Free Comic Book Day and Halloween. They have some back issues, including some nice expensive finds on the wall and behind the glass, but since it's not the biggest shop in the world, you could probably look elsewhere for that. The customer service and atmosphere is what I come for, though, so it's my first and primary destination for new books.
